Output 31fc5fa572d662825e21f08bd72e5aaa8818912ccf2bbebfa79aacb9a72169b2:4

value
18553050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ba91d4fc091fe44c8787b86d4aafd39e1602396 OP_EQUAL
address
3LFsgmRHtW7WCX6QPDijwAXMPadQpn2jU9
transaction
31fc5fa572d662825e21f08bd72e5aaa8818912ccf2bbebfa79aacb9a72169b2
spent
true